BOUSTEAD DELIVERS SPECIAL BUS FOR THE PHYSICALLY CHALLENGED
KUALA
LUMPUR, June 8, 2009 - In
a unique gesture of appreciation to those who place the safeguard
of our nation ahead of themselves, Boustead Holdings Berhad (Boustead
Group) contributed a specially configured bus to the Community Rehabilitation
Center of the Malaysian Armed Forces (PPDK).
The initiative
was part of the Boustead Group's corporate social responsibility
(CSR) commitment to contribute positively to the lives of members
of the Malaysian Armed Forces and their families.
The bus is possibly
the first of its kind in Malaysia as it features a unique automated
lift that does not require the physically challenged to alight from
their wheelchair when getting onto or getting off the bus. The stairs
of the bus are also built for easy access. Worth approximately RM400,000,
this BMC-make vehicle can ferry up to 25 passengers with additional
space for wheelchairs. Additionally, the bus is also equipped with
air-conditioning and audio-visual facilities for passengers.

Since
its inception as a modest trading entity more than 180 years ago,
the Boustead Group has grown by leaps and bounds to comprise more
than 80 subsidiary and associate companies, and has substantial
interests in various sectors of the Malaysian economy. The Boustead
Group's operations are focused in six key areas; plantation, heavy
industries, property, finance & investment, trading and
manufacturing & services. As at 31 December 2008, Boustead
Holdings Berhad's paid-up capital is RM326 million, while its shareholders'
funds stand at RM2.9 billion.
